What changed here

Derived

The seat changed hands: Indian National Congress (INC) lost it to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P), which now leads by 6.4%.

Boundaries were redrawn between 2003 and 2008 — the comparison is matched by name and is indicative only.

  • BJP vote shareBJP went from 23.3% to 48.0% of the vote here (+24.6%).
  • Vote consolidatedThe top two candidates took 89.5% of the vote between them, up from 62.9% — a tighter two-way contest.
